3 Figure 2 (A) Forest plot showing the visual analog scale (VAS) for procedural pain for women undergoing diagnostic hysteroscopy. Standardized mean difference (SMD) is shown with 95% confidence interval (CI). (B) Forest plot showing the incidence of shoulder pain in women undergoing diagnostic hysteroscopy. Risk ratio (RR) is shown with 95% CI. (C) Forest plot showing the incidence of side effects in women undergoing diagnostic hysteroscopy. RR is shown with 95% CI. (D) Forest plot showing the satisfaction expressed as VAS for women undergoing diagnostic hysteroscopy. SMD is shown with 95% CI. (E) Forest plot showing the satisfaction expressed as acceptance of the same procedure for women undergoing diagnostic hysteroscopy. RR is shown with 95% CI. (F) Forest plot showing the quality of view expressed as incidence of unsatisfactory view in women undergoing diagnostic hysteroscopy. RR is shown with 95% CI. (G) Forest plot showing the duration of procedure in women undergoing diagnostic hysteroscopy. SMD is shown with 95% CI. NS = normal saline.
